Navicat和SQL数据库用户权限怎么设置 SQL数据库用户权限设置流程

28 次阅读

要在Navicat中给数据库表设置权限,先别急,咱们一点一点来。先打开Navicat,在数据库对象列表里找到目标表,右键点击它。在弹出的菜单中,你会看到“设计表”或者“权限”选项,如果看到“权限”,太棒,可以直接点进去设置;要是没看到别着急,选“设计表”后再找“权限”或“设置权限”页签,具体位置可能因为Navicat版本不同稍有差异。操作起来挺简单的,主要是给用户分配SELECTINSERTUPDATEDELETE等权限,让用户能按需操作。

数据库权限设定

SQL Server数据库用户和权限怎么设置

数据库权限设置看着复杂,但其实分步骤来超easy:

  1. 打开SQL Server Management Studio(简称SSMS),登录你的数据库实例。
  2. 展开“安全性”节点,找到“登录名”,点击右键,选择“新建登录名”。
  3. 在“常规”选项卡里,给新用户创建登录名,设定默认数据库。
  4. 切换到“用户映射”页签,勾选你想赋权的数据库,并设置对应的架构。
  5. 确认无误后点“确定”,用户就创建好了。
  6. 接下来在“安全性”中找到刚创建的用户,右键点击,选择“属性”,再到“权限”标签。
  7. 点击“添加”,浏览并选择需要授权的数据库对象,比如表或视图。
  8. 勾选你希望赋予用户的各种权限,诸如查询、插入、更新、删除等,完成后点“确认”。
  9. 最后别忘了验证一下:关闭SSMS,重新用新账号登录,确保权限设置没问题。

整个过程就像搭积木一样,按部就班,轻轻松松搞定你想要的权限。

数据库权限设定

相关问题解答

  1. Navicat中找不到权限设置该怎么办?
    哎,这个问题很普遍哦!其实Navicat不同版本菜单会有点区别,如果你没看到“权限”选项,别担心,先右键点“设计表”,然后在设计窗口找“权限”标签,或者刷新一下Navicat试试。有时候更新到最新版本也能解决。好啦,就是这么简单!

  2. 新建SQL Server用户时要注意什么?
    嘿,新建用户时,记得“登录名”和“用户映射”两个部分不能马虎。登录名负责验证身份,而用户映射决定你会被赋予哪些数据库和权限。初次设置尤其要检查密码复杂度,别用123456喔!做好了这些,权限配置自然顺利多了。

  3. 如何确保数据库用户权限安全又灵活?
    说真的,权限配置要严中带松。按需授予最重要,不要给用户过多权限,防止出现数据泄露或意外改动。比如只允许查询的账号就别轻易赋予写入权限,同时要定期检查和更新权限,保持权限最贴合实际需求。

  4. SQL Server登录失败怎么办?
    哎呀,登录失败真让人头疼!通常是用户名或密码输错啦,或者账号被锁定。建议先冰箱冷静一下,确认密码没问题,账号没过期或禁用。还有,认证方式也要搞清楚,是Windows认证还是SQL身份验证,选错了也登录不了。慢慢试,没准儿立马就解决啦!

发布评论

洪晓汐 2025-12-01
我发布了文章《Navicat和SQL数据库用户权限怎么设置 SQL数据库用户权限设置流程》,希望对大家有用!欢迎在数码科技中查看更多精彩内容。
用户112401 1小时前
关于《Navicat和SQL数据库用户权限怎么设置 SQL数据库用户权限设置流程》这篇文章,洪晓汐的写作风格很清晰,特别是内容分析这部分,学到了很多新知识!
用户112402 1天前
在数码科技看到这篇2025-12-01发布的文章,卡片式布局很美观,内容组织得井井有条,特别是作者洪晓汐的排版,阅读体验非常好!